The oldest part of the castle is the mighty tower. Its origin goes back to the thirteenth century.
In that time it had to protect the road "running through the valley, a by-road of the Wuerzburg
highway, which already in the middle-ages was the most important road through the Spessard.
The main part of the tower was built by the knight Hamann Echter in the early fifteenth century
(1419-1432). It now contains the family-archives and the library. The oldest document you find in it
is of the thirteenth century.
